Output 3a8fae5bac5a07814739e2479a24f29f1b347529633bd442f21743e835007027:0

value
557970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b52674707cf1a11091ead6c354b194acb9b9ece OP_EQUAL
address
34BUtDM8pzA78TTKuz6bGJfDb4pMCRx36A
transaction
3a8fae5bac5a07814739e2479a24f29f1b347529633bd442f21743e835007027
spent
true